Wifi weather map for conferences
Here’s my lazyweb idea of the day. Someone really needs to invent something that combines wifi connectivity / strength / load information with GPS. Should run in the background on laptops or phones and periodically update to a central location. Stir, repeat, and spit out a map for big conferences like JavaOne so that you can know where to go for connectivity.
